The LittleGiant TreeHaus Camper is a modular cargo, utility, and camping trailer system ideal for use as the all-in-one adventure solution. Enjoy the performance-driven construction and pick up bed functionality of the LittleGiant Trailer for hauling all your gear on the highway or the high country, while converting into our roomiest tent trailer at your destination. Featuring lightweight aluminum deck panels and fittings for extending outward from each side of the trailer bed, and a domed tent design with ample standing height, the LittleGiant TreeHaus Camper provides great sleeping and living space for four people and gear.

  • LittleGiant TreeHaus™ Camper Includes: LittleGiant Trailer™, two 84”L x 22”W aluminum deck panels with mounting hardware and storage hardware, end gate camper retrofit hardware, TreeHaus tent shelter

  • Trailer Bed Dimensions: 86” L x 54” W x 24” H solid-walled trailer bed interior carries all forms of cargo, from light-duty industrial equipment, construction material and personal travel and lifestyle gear

  • Camper Dimensions: 84”L x 101”W x 82”H (camper bed setup); 121”L x 74”W x 42”H (overall trailer with TreeHaus system stored inside)

  • Weights: 480 lbs (LittleGiant Trailer), 85 lbs (TreeHaus Camping System)

  • Payload capacity: 1,500 lbs; G.V.W.R: 2,065 lbs

  • Easy Setup: The TreeHaus tent secures over the deck panels and around the trailer perimeter with heavy-duty velcro. The canopy sleeves and eight fiberglass body poles are color coded to aid in set up. The rainfly simply pulls over the canopy and attaches with hook and loop

  • Compact Storage: The tent and the poles are conveniently stored in a small canvas bag weighing 20 lbs, while the two 26 lbs lightweight aluminum deck panels store vertically along the inside side walls of the trailer bed. With the decks compactly stored, the trailer bed interior is available for transport camping, recreation equipment, travel and related lifestyle goods

  • TreeHaus Shelter: Includes tent canopy with rainfly, ten fiberglass body and awning poles, tie-in tent tubing for secure cordless attachment of tent and rainfly to trailer, tie-outs with ground stakes for weather reinforcement, gear loft for flashlights and personal items, Power Port passageway for electrical cords in and out

  • Spacious Interior: The foot print of the TreeHaus tent is the trailer bed and installed deck panel wings that in total measure 101”W x 84” long for 60 sq. ft of living space. Additionally, each end gate fits across the inside width of the trailer body for an expansive 48”L x 101”W raised sleep and living surface way above the ground!

  • Extra Tall: The domed tent gives the interior a special, open and airy feel and the center of the tent is 6’10” high for plenty of headroom

  • Open Breathable Design: Zippered combination screen doors are on each end of the camper, with large mesh bay windows on the sides. The storm fly can be removed revealing a natural skylight roof to let the sun and stars shine in. Finely screened opening keep out bugs and lets in fresh air for great ventilation and beautiful views

  • Tent Canopy: The shelter fabric is made of durable polyester with a 185 denier rated nylon ripstop. A polyurethane coating gives the fabric a 2,000mm PU waterproof rating for a lifetime of use. This is about three times the waterproof rating of a typical tent bought at a sporting goods store

  • Rainfly: 185-denier polyester nylon coated with a 2,000mm polyurethane waterproof rated storm fly clips over the tent for great weather protection and added heat retention

  • Large Bay Windows: Zippered screened bay windows on both sides of the trailer for breezy ventilation, daydreaming, and sight-seeing

Trailer Construction:

  • All-galvanized steel construction with black powder coat finished sheet metal body for lifelong durability, 14ga. x 2” frame tubes, and 18ga. floor, sidewall, end gate sheet metal
  • Integrated C-Channel track on sidewalls for cargo management and modular attachments (84” x 1.625” x 13/16”)
  • Removable front and rear end gates
  • Torsion axle with grease zert bearing lubrication for independent, quiet, rubber dampened suspension, structural body strength, and low maintenance
  • 13 inch silver rim, 24in diameter tires (ST175-80D-13 load range B); 5 x 4.5 bolt hole pattern
  • Jeep style steel Fenders with black powder coat finish
  • A-Frame drawbar for strength and load stability with 2” coupler, 30 lbs tongue weight
  • LED 4” red square stop, turn, taillights with license plate illumination EPDM shielded wire harness with 4-flat electrical plug
  • Trailer marine swivel jack, height adjustable with 5” castor wheel, 1000 lbs rated
  • Swing down stabilizer leveler jacks for mobility and stability both on and off the hitch (12”-18” extended, 650 lbs capacity per jack)
  • 15 inch ground clearance for 15 inch recommended ball height (tow ball not included)
  • Rated for Class I towing or higher
  • Made in the USA
  • Complete bolt-together kit, assembly required
